Stop in the quarters for Barbara Dessolis, engaged in the Miva Open in Valenza, in the province of Alessandria, which saw 77 athletes fighting on the courts of the Nuovo Tennis Paradiso.
Bitter defeat. The standard bearer of Tc Cagliari (2.3), credited with the fourth seed, was eliminated in the quarter-finals by the Tuscan pariclassification Jessica Bertoldo, number 5 of the seeding, who won her comeback 0-6, 6-4, 6 -3. Dessolis had made his debut in the previous round, regulating the 2.6 Piedmontese Elisa Viganò 6-0, 6-2.
The latter had stopped another Sardinian tennis player, Elisa Patta (2.6, Torres Tennis) with a double 6-3 in the round of 32. The Torresina had made its debut in the third section of the scoreboard, overcoming the Lombard Valeria Pezzoli 7-6, 3-0, to then complete another comeback with withdrawal in the final scoreboard: 1-6, 6-3, 5-2 on the 2.4 Aurora Urso from Lombardy.
Ogno also leaves the scene. In Piedmont there was also Anastasia Ogno (3.2, Tc Alghero), who passed "section 2" by lining up the 3.3 Piedmontese Anna Principato 6-3, 6-2 and Sophia Corradi the 3.1 Emilian 0-6, 7- 5, 6-4, and then hit another positive by beating 6-3, 6-2 the 2.8 Lombard Angel Sofia Parisi, before yielding 6-2, 6-1 to the 2-6 Marche Ilaria Sposetti.
